Let’s reopen doors to ex-Umno leaders, says Puteri wing chief


-filepic

KUALA LUMPUR: Umno must take the first step towards national political reconciliation by reopening its doors to former leaders so they can return to the party, says Datuk Nurul Amal Mohd Fauzi.

The Puteri Umno chief said a form of political peace must be initiated by Umno immediately.

"Ten prime ministers come from Umno.

"Umno must not be exclusive, the party’s doors must be opened as wide as possible to those who want to uphold our struggle or wants to be friends with us," she said in her policy speech at the Puteri Umno assembly here at World Trade Centre (WTC) KL here on Thursday (Jan 15).

This openness is Umno’s strength and what allows the party to continue to endure and grow, she said.

"Let us rebuild this 'house', a house that was once a symbol of hope and sacrifice.

"To those who wish to return, we welcome you with open hearts.

"Let us reconnect the bonds that were broken, and build our resolve and step forward for the future of the nation," she added.
